日本黄色一级经典视频|伊人久久精品视频|亚洲黄色色周成人视频九九九|av免费网址黄色小短片|黄色Av无码亚洲成年人|亚洲1区2区3区无码|真人黄片免费观看|无码一级小说欧美日免费三级|日韩中文字幕91在线看|精品久久久无码中文字幕边打电话

當(dāng)前位置:首頁 > 通信技術(shù) > 通信技術(shù)
[導(dǎo)讀]摘要:針對于海洋特殊的環(huán)境,數(shù)據(jù)傳輸能力不能滿足海洋環(huán)境檢測的需求現(xiàn)狀,文中提出將多種無線傳輸方式與AT91SAM9260結(jié)合構(gòu)造多模式浮標(biāo)岸基數(shù)據(jù)收發(fā)平臺(tái)的設(shè)計(jì)方案,并給出具體的通信協(xié)議。同時(shí),用VC++語言設(shè)計(jì)了

摘要:針對于海洋特殊的環(huán)境,數(shù)據(jù)傳輸能力不能滿足海洋環(huán)境檢測的需求現(xiàn)狀,文中提出將多種無線傳輸方式與AT91SAM9260結(jié)合構(gòu)造多模式浮標(biāo)岸基數(shù)據(jù)收發(fā)平臺(tái)的設(shè)計(jì)方案,并給出具體的通信協(xié)議。同時(shí),用VC++語言設(shè)計(jì)了岸基數(shù)據(jù)接收服務(wù)中心軟件。本設(shè)計(jì)已成功用于海洋數(shù)據(jù)傳輸,對我國海洋環(huán)境檢測技術(shù)的發(fā)展有較大的意義。
關(guān)鍵詞:海洋通信;無線傳輸;多模;AT91SAM9260;協(xié)議

    海洋占據(jù)了地球表面的三分之二以上面積,并以其豐富的資源、廣闊的空間以及對地球環(huán)境氣候的巨大調(diào)節(jié)作用,成為全球生態(tài)系統(tǒng)和人類發(fā)展的一個(gè)重要組成部分,因此,發(fā)展海洋科技,尤其是海洋高新技術(shù)已成為世界新技術(shù)革命的重要內(nèi)容。然而,由于海洋特殊的環(huán)境,使得很多在陸地上已經(jīng)運(yùn)用自如且性能良好的通信技術(shù)無法在海洋上使用,ARG0是以10~14天為周期通過衛(wèi)星系統(tǒng)來傳輸?shù)模Q笸ㄐ偶夹g(shù)成為了限制海洋技術(shù)發(fā)展的瓶頸。本文設(shè)計(jì)的基于AT91SAM9260的多模式浮標(biāo)岸基數(shù)據(jù)收發(fā)平臺(tái)將多種數(shù)據(jù)傳輸方式集合在一起,很好的滿足了海洋數(shù)據(jù)全天侯長時(shí)間傳輸?shù)男枨蟆?br />
1 系統(tǒng)概述
   
基于AT91SAM9260的多模式浮標(biāo)岸基數(shù)據(jù)收發(fā)平臺(tái)(以下簡稱收發(fā)平臺(tái))系統(tǒng)結(jié)構(gòu)圖如圖1所示,本系統(tǒng)提供了四種通信方式:無線通信、數(shù)傳電臺(tái)通信、GPRS通信和銥星通信。這四種通信方式由AT91SAM920配置和管理,依據(jù)一定的通信選擇策略實(shí)現(xiàn)四種通信方式的智能切換。圖中,實(shí)線為電源線、長虛線為天線連接線、點(diǎn)虛線為串口通信信號(hào)線。


    CPU是系統(tǒng)的核心,通過COM2~COM5依次與銥星模塊、無線模塊、速傳電臺(tái)模塊及GPRS模塊相連。COM6為用戶接口,可依據(jù)協(xié)議對本系統(tǒng)進(jìn)行配置及實(shí)現(xiàn)數(shù)據(jù)傳輸,COM7為調(diào)試串口,可打印系統(tǒng)的運(yùn)行信息,并可實(shí)現(xiàn)系統(tǒng)深入配置。
    系統(tǒng)中各種通信方式各有優(yōu)點(diǎn):如果浮標(biāo)是部署在近海,可以直接通過無線模塊進(jìn)行通信,不但速度快而且無需資費(fèi);若距離有所增加,則可以使用無線數(shù)傳電臺(tái),此時(shí)仍可獲得較快的傳輸速率。若無線模塊和無線數(shù)傳電臺(tái)不能滿足需求,則可以使用GPRS,此時(shí)傳輸速率有所下降,且有較小延時(shí);若在遠(yuǎn)海,則可以使用銥星模塊。本系統(tǒng)可以同時(shí)滿足近海和遠(yuǎn)海數(shù)據(jù)通信的需求。

2 系統(tǒng)原理
2.1 通信方式智能切換選擇策略
   
本收發(fā)平臺(tái)使用的選擇策略主要是:優(yōu)先級選擇策略、信號(hào)質(zhì)量選擇策略和通信保持策略。
    優(yōu)先級選擇策略:由于四種通信方式有不同的傳輸速率、不同的傳輸距離和不同的延遲,同時(shí)考慮到海洋上特殊的環(huán)境以及盡量高速率、長傳輸距離、小延遲的通信要求,所以設(shè)置無線模塊、數(shù)傳電臺(tái)模塊、GPRS模塊及銥星模塊的優(yōu)先級依次為0~3,值越小,優(yōu)先級越高,同時(shí)可以依據(jù)協(xié)議由用戶設(shè)置模塊優(yōu)先級。
    信號(hào)質(zhì)量選擇策略:系統(tǒng)在運(yùn)行后,會(huì)運(yùn)行通信守護(hù)進(jìn)程,并定時(shí)檢測各通信方式的信號(hào)質(zhì)量,從而進(jìn)一步保證通信的正常進(jìn)行。
    通信保持策略:收發(fā)平臺(tái)會(huì)優(yōu)先使用最近使用過的通信方式,若該通信方式故障,則會(huì)嘗試盡量多的次數(shù)來完成未完成的數(shù)據(jù)傳輸。用戶可依據(jù)協(xié)議設(shè)置嘗試次數(shù)及超時(shí)時(shí)間。
    用戶也可以依據(jù)協(xié)議設(shè)置以上三種策略的優(yōu)先關(guān)系。
2.2 通信協(xié)議制定
   
通信協(xié)議是通信能否正常進(jìn)行的重要保證。本收發(fā)平臺(tái)具有如下特點(diǎn):一、用戶與收發(fā)平臺(tái)之間的通信需要有基本的重發(fā)確認(rèn)機(jī)制,考慮到使用RS232通信鏈路重復(fù)出現(xiàn)故障的可能性叫小,所以該機(jī)制不需要復(fù)雜;二、用戶需要對收發(fā)平臺(tái)進(jìn)行簡單的配置;三、收發(fā)平臺(tái)之間的通性應(yīng)該可以實(shí)現(xiàn)定點(diǎn)傳輸、廣播傳輸及轉(zhuǎn)發(fā)。因此,協(xié)議的制定至少包括兩個(gè)方面:用戶與收發(fā)平臺(tái)通信協(xié)議和收發(fā)平臺(tái)間通信協(xié)議。


    圖2所示為用戶與收發(fā)平臺(tái)通信協(xié)議。劃分為三層:物理層、傳輸層、應(yīng)用層。各層功能如下:物理層提供數(shù)據(jù)的實(shí)際傳輸,由RS232來完成,傳輸層只需以字節(jié)為單位發(fā)送數(shù)據(jù)即可;傳輸層負(fù)責(zé)檢測網(wǎng)絡(luò)狀態(tài)以及數(shù)據(jù)幀的提?。粦?yīng)用層依據(jù)幀類型完成用戶要執(zhí)行的操作。協(xié)議中:起始字符為“@”,占1字節(jié);數(shù)據(jù)長度為幀中數(shù)據(jù)字段的長度,占1字節(jié);校驗(yàn)和對全幀進(jìn)行校驗(yàn),若為0,則表示忽略校驗(yàn),占1字節(jié);結(jié)束字符為“#”,占1字節(jié)。
    幀類型占1字節(jié),具體如下:
    0:此時(shí)數(shù)據(jù)段為要發(fā)送的數(shù)據(jù),收發(fā)平臺(tái)不必理會(huì)其內(nèi)容,類似于透明傳輸,且通過何種方式傳輸由收發(fā)平臺(tái)決定;
    1:與類型0相似,但使用由用戶指定的通信方式,0為無線通信、1為無線數(shù)傳電臺(tái)、2為GPRS、3為銥星,其它值表示不使用該通信方式;
    2:對用戶指定的通信方式設(shè)定通信速率,0為9 600 bps,1為19 200 bps,此時(shí),數(shù)據(jù)字段長度應(yīng)為兩字節(jié);
    3:此時(shí)數(shù)據(jù)字段應(yīng)為四字節(jié),依次為通信方式0~3的優(yōu)先級,且不可重復(fù);
    4:此時(shí)數(shù)據(jù)字段應(yīng)為三字節(jié),依次代表重發(fā)次數(shù)、發(fā)送超時(shí)時(shí)間(占兩字節(jié)),單位為毫秒。
    5:設(shè)置收發(fā)平臺(tái)的目的地址,此時(shí)數(shù)據(jù)字段應(yīng)為一字節(jié),無需每次都設(shè)定;
    255:此時(shí)數(shù)據(jù)字段長度為零,表示對用戶發(fā)來的數(shù)據(jù)進(jìn)行確認(rèn)。
    圖3所示為收發(fā)平臺(tái)間通信協(xié)議,劃分為兩層:物理層、傳輸層。各層功能如下:物理層提供數(shù)據(jù)的實(shí)際傳輸,對于無線模塊和數(shù)傳電臺(tái),提供的是連續(xù)的字節(jié)流傳輸,對于GPRS和銥星,提供的是不連續(xù)的以字節(jié)為最小單位的塊數(shù)據(jù)傳輸;傳輸層負(fù)責(zé)數(shù)據(jù)幀的提取,依據(jù)目的地址和該節(jié)點(diǎn)地址,接收、轉(zhuǎn)發(fā)或丟棄數(shù)據(jù)包,并提取接收數(shù)據(jù)包中的數(shù)據(jù)字段傳輸給用戶,且在任何時(shí)候都只接收但不轉(zhuǎn)發(fā)目的地址為廣播的數(shù)據(jù)包。協(xié)議中:起始字符為“@”,占1字節(jié);目的地址占用1字節(jié),255為廣播地址;源地址占用1字節(jié);跳數(shù)為數(shù)據(jù)包可以被轉(zhuǎn)發(fā)的次數(shù),為0時(shí)丟棄;數(shù)據(jù)長度為包中數(shù)據(jù)字段的長度,占1字節(jié);校驗(yàn)和對數(shù)據(jù)長度和數(shù)據(jù)字段進(jìn)行校驗(yàn),若為0,則表示忽略校驗(yàn),占1字節(jié);結(jié)束字符為“#”,占1字節(jié)。



3 硬件設(shè)計(jì)
   
考慮到收發(fā)平臺(tái)需要至少五路RS232接口,且可能要同時(shí)操作四種通信方式來傳輸數(shù)據(jù),綜合考慮,選用處理能力強(qiáng)的AT91SAM9260作為CPU;選用9XTend作為無線收發(fā)模塊,該模塊在使用高增益天線時(shí)最遠(yuǎn)可達(dá)64 km,使用偶極天線時(shí)通信距離可達(dá)22 km;選用通信距離更遠(yuǎn)的型號(hào)為MDS2710C的無線SCADA數(shù)傳電臺(tái)模塊;選用型號(hào)為GF-2008AW的GPRS模塊;選用9522A L-Band銥星收發(fā)模塊通過銥星衛(wèi)星與陸地基站進(jìn)行通信。同時(shí),為了存儲(chǔ)未能及時(shí)發(fā)出去的數(shù)據(jù)以及系統(tǒng)配置,添加SD卡作為存儲(chǔ)介質(zhì)。圖4所示為收發(fā)平臺(tái)硬件框圖。



4 軟件設(shè)計(jì)
4.1 主控AT91SAM9260程序設(shè)計(jì)
   
收發(fā)平臺(tái)要完成的功能主要是:與用戶通信、四種通信方式的控制與維護(hù)、數(shù)據(jù)存儲(chǔ)。開機(jī)后,收發(fā)平臺(tái)CPU讀取系統(tǒng)配置進(jìn)行初始化,包括CPU本身初始化、RS232接口初始化、SD卡接口初始化、定時(shí)器初始化、通信模塊初始化。之后系統(tǒng)進(jìn)入工作狀態(tài)。圖5所示為收發(fā)平臺(tái)正常工作時(shí)軟件流程圖,若某個(gè)通信模塊出現(xiàn)故障,CPU會(huì)關(guān)閉該模塊,當(dāng)四種通信模塊都出現(xiàn)故障時(shí),CPU將通知用戶,對于用戶發(fā)送的數(shù)據(jù)均不作出響應(yīng)。


4.2 上位機(jī)軟件設(shè)計(jì)
   
上位機(jī)軟件即岸基數(shù)據(jù)接收服務(wù)中心軟件完成計(jì)算機(jī)用戶與收發(fā)平臺(tái)間的通信,主要包括以下功能:收發(fā)平臺(tái)的配置、數(shù)據(jù)的接收與發(fā)送、數(shù)據(jù)的圖表化顯示及存儲(chǔ)、歷史數(shù)據(jù)的顯示與分析。圖6所示為上位機(jī)軟件主界面。


    上位機(jī)軟件使用Visual C++語言設(shè)計(jì),窗口設(shè)計(jì)主要包括主窗口、系統(tǒng)配置窗口、歷史數(shù)據(jù)分析窗口。主界面接收數(shù)據(jù)圖表顯示區(qū)能反映接收到的數(shù)據(jù)的變化趨勢,并可向收發(fā)平臺(tái)傳輸數(shù)據(jù),實(shí)現(xiàn)收發(fā)平臺(tái)的配置和數(shù)據(jù)收發(fā)。歷史數(shù)據(jù)分析窗口能以圖表方式反映歷史數(shù)據(jù)。

5 結(jié)束語
   
本收發(fā)平臺(tái)目前可以支持網(wǎng)絡(luò)內(nèi)存在最多255個(gè)收發(fā)平臺(tái),已經(jīng)滿足了當(dāng)前的需求,并已成功用于海洋數(shù)據(jù)傳輸。在后續(xù)改進(jìn)中,可設(shè)計(jì)實(shí)現(xiàn)多個(gè)收發(fā)平臺(tái)的組網(wǎng)傳輸,進(jìn)而更大程度上滿足數(shù)據(jù)長時(shí)間全天候傳輸?shù)男枨蟆?/p>

本站聲明: 本文章由作者或相關(guān)機(jī)構(gòu)授權(quán)發(fā)布,目的在于傳遞更多信息,并不代表本站贊同其觀點(diǎn),本站亦不保證或承諾內(nèi)容真實(shí)性等。需要轉(zhuǎn)載請聯(lián)系該專欄作者,如若文章內(nèi)容侵犯您的權(quán)益,請及時(shí)聯(lián)系本站刪除。
換一批
延伸閱讀

柏林2025年9月9日 /美通社/ -- 2025年9月5日,納斯達(dá)克上市公司優(yōu)克聯(lián)集團(tuán)(NASDAQ: UCL)旗下全球互聯(lián)品牌GlocalMe,正式亮相柏林國際消費(fèi)電子展(IFA 2025),重磅推出融合企...

關(guān)鍵字: LOCAL LM BSP 移動(dòng)網(wǎng)絡(luò)

深圳2025年9月9日 /美通社/ -- PART 01活動(dòng)背景 當(dāng)技術(shù)的鋒芒刺穿行業(yè)壁壘,萬物互聯(lián)的生態(tài)正重塑產(chǎn)業(yè)疆域。2025年,物聯(lián)網(wǎng)產(chǎn)業(yè)邁入?"破界創(chuàng)造"與"共生進(jìn)化"?的裂變時(shí)代——AI大模型消融感知邊界,...

關(guān)鍵字: BSP 模型 微信 AIOT

"出海無界 商機(jī)無限"助力企業(yè)構(gòu)建全球競爭力 深圳2025年9月9日 /美通社/ -- 2025年8月28日, 由領(lǐng)先商業(yè)管理媒體世界經(jīng)理人攜手環(huán)球資源聯(lián)合主辦、深圳?前海出海e站通協(xié)辦的...

關(guān)鍵字: 解碼 供應(yīng)鏈 AI BSP

柏林2025年9月9日 /美通社/ -- 柏林當(dāng)?shù)貢r(shí)間9月6日,在2025德國柏林國際電子消費(fèi)品展覽會(huì)(International Funkausstellung...

關(guān)鍵字: 掃地機(jī)器人 耳機(jī) PEN BSP

武漢2025年9月9日 /美通社/ -- 7月24日,2025慧聰跨業(yè)品牌巡展——湖北?武漢站在武漢中南花園酒店隆重舉辦!本次巡展由慧聰安防網(wǎng)、慧聰物聯(lián)網(wǎng)、慧聰音響燈光網(wǎng)、慧聰LED屏網(wǎng)、慧聰教育網(wǎng)聯(lián)合主辦,吸引了安防、...

關(guān)鍵字: AI 希捷 BSP 平板

上海2025年9月9日 /美通社/ -- 9月8日,移遠(yuǎn)通信宣布,其自研藍(lán)牙協(xié)議棧DynaBlue率先通過藍(lán)牙技術(shù)聯(lián)盟(SIG)BQB 6.1標(biāo)準(zhǔn)認(rèn)證。作為移遠(yuǎn)深耕短距離通信...

關(guān)鍵字: 藍(lán)牙協(xié)議棧 移遠(yuǎn)通信 COM BSP

上海2025年9月9日 /美通社/ -- 為全面落實(shí)黨中央、國務(wù)院和上海市委、市政府關(guān)于加快發(fā)展人力資源服務(wù)業(yè)的決策部署,更好發(fā)揮人力資源服務(wù)業(yè)賦能百業(yè)作用,8月29日,以"AI智領(lǐng) HR智鏈 靜候你來&quo...

關(guān)鍵字: 智能體 AI BSP 人工智能

北京2025年9月8日 /美通社/ -- 近日,易生支付與一汽出行達(dá)成合作,為其自主研發(fā)的"旗馭車管"車輛運(yùn)營管理平臺(tái)提供全流程支付通道及技術(shù)支持。此次合作不僅提升了平臺(tái)對百余家企業(yè)客戶的運(yùn)營管理效率...

關(guān)鍵字: 一汽 智能化 BSP SAAS

深圳2025年9月8日 /美通社/ -- 晶泰科技(2228.HK)今日宣布,由其助力智擎生技制藥(PharmaEngine, Inc.)發(fā)現(xiàn)的新一代PRMT5抑制劑PEP0...

關(guān)鍵字: 泰科 AI MT BSP

上海2025年9月5日 /美通社/ -- 由上海市經(jīng)濟(jì)和信息化委員會(huì)、上海市發(fā)展和改革委員會(huì)、上海市商務(wù)委員會(huì)、上海市教育委員會(huì)、上海市科學(xué)技術(shù)委員會(huì)指導(dǎo),東浩蘭生(集團(tuán))有限公司主辦,東浩蘭生會(huì)展集團(tuán)上海工業(yè)商務(wù)展覽有...

關(guān)鍵字: 電子 BSP 芯片 自動(dòng)駕駛
關(guān)閉